[Challenges in managing diabetes in chronic hemodialysis]
Faiza Lamine1, Haithem Chtioui2, Nora Schwotzer3
1Service d'endocrinologie, diabétologie et métabolisme, CHUV, 1011 Lausanne.
Abstract:
Hemodialysis (HD) centers are facing an increasing number of patients with diabetes. These cases require an intensive multidisciplinary approach of the consequences of renal failure, glycemic control and nutrition and the management of frequent co-morbidities, in particular the diabetic foot. A major challenge is to decrease glycemic variability and the risk of hypoglycemia. Because of increased risk of hypoglycemia-associated mortality, the HbA1C target is loosened in the majority of HD patients. Continuous glucose monitoring technology has identified important glycemic fluctuations during and after dialysis. However, their reliability in HD needs to be improved. New therapeutic pathways that decrease glucose excursions and hypoglycemia, such as GLP1 receptor agonists and sensor-coupled insulin pumps, have yet to be validated in HD.
